Santiago has mountains all arround so pollutions is stuck there most of the time. The goverment constantly tries to keep it low but with no rains is pretty much impossible. wait for the views after it rains... it's 100000000% better btw welcome to Chile!

@IceSpoon
@IceSpoon 5 лет назад
Come in Autumn or spring, if you can make it to September (Chile's national holidays) then you'll see it at its best. Summer can be waaaaaaaaay too hot and winter has the risk of being too smoggy and you won't see a thing in Sky Costanera or San Cristóbal. Also, go to Bellavista BUT - DO - NOT go to Patio Bellavista. Biggest tourist trap in the whole city. Go to any bar or pub nearby. They're the same, 100x better and 1000x cheaper :D Source: Living in Santiago for almost a decade now.
